Ticket #—: Missed pick-up, stage props

Status: reopened. Thornquist Staging missed yesterday's slot for the Gilded Lantern tour crates (3x flight cases, dock B). Props needed in Haverbrook by Friday load-in. New pick-up booked for tomorrow 07:00. Shift lead: have crates staged and strapped by 06:30, manifests taped to lids. No partial release — all three go together. Relay the following to the driver at hand-over.

dispatch memo: the lamwyn fenwyn courier leaves the wenir ledger at gate 7175 under passcode 822969

# Parcelhop webhook service env.
# This file configures the tracker that receives carrier
# status pings and forwards them to the Driftline queue.
# Set WEBHOOK_PORT and QUEUE_URL before first run.
# Inbound requests are verified against a shared signing
# credential. The line below sets it.

vault entry, yahif-yajep: COURIER_KEY29=b802bdf8034096b65a51c6ba5abe2

## Service Accounts — StormFan Alert Fan-Out

The fan-out worker authenticates to the internal dispatch tier using the svc-stormfan account. Rotate quarterly; scopes are limited to publish-only on alert topics. If deliveries stall during your shift, verify the worker is using the current credential, reproduced below for reference.

API key for kaweg-hahif: kto4_rAjZ

## Local Setup

The Quillgate service wraps the upstream Harrowfield API with a circuit breaker. Defaults: 5 failures trip it, 30s half-open window. For local runs, start the stub upstream first (`make stub-up`), then the service (`make run`). Breaker state persists to the local database so restarts don't reset trip counts — the release manager should verify state is clean before tagging a build. Seed the schema with `make migrate`, which reads the connection string below.

replica DSN, kajep-yahag: mssql://praok_svc:iF@db-8d68.plorvaio.local:5432/eliion

# Tollgate Consent Banner — Environments

The Tollgate consent banner rolls out across three environments: sandbox, preview, and production. Sandbox disables consent persistence entirely; preview stores choices in Varnholt-region storage only; production enforces regional residency. Reviewers should confirm that logging excludes pre-consent identifiers. Each environment's enforced configuration appears below.

config for hawep-taweg:
[frair]
port = 8443
region = west-3
host = frair.sivrelhq.internal
team = oliael
timeout_ms = 1000
retries = 2